Tapping Machines Reduce Setup Times, Material Handling
Palmgren’s Parallel Arm Tapping machines are designed to make tapping fast and easy by reducing setup times and material handling as well as improving material flow.

Customers can select the pneumatic tapping arm system, motor and toolholder that best meets their needs. The Quick-Tap system features a working area reach of 37" and is best suited for small and medium-size taps. The Shop-Tap is capable of general-purpose tapping and has a working area reach of 62". With a working area reach of 55", the Production-Tap can be used for a range of general-purpose to heavy-duty tapping.
